日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 编程资源 > 编程问答 >内容正文

编程问答

LoadRunner-登陆web tours订票网站,预订一张机票后退出-1

發布時間:2024/1/8 编程问答 38 豆豆
生活随笔 收集整理的這篇文章主要介紹了 LoadRunner-登陆web tours订票网站,预订一张机票后退出-1 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

測試需求:登陸web tours訂票網站,預訂一張機票后退出

一、Recording錄制腳本 1.啟動web服務器“Start Web Server” 2.打開“virtual ?user generator” 3.創建一個新的腳本,選擇腳本協議(web(HTTP/HTML)) 4.設置:application type、program to record、URL address、working directory、record into action、record the application startup 5.開始錄制,自動打開web tours網頁,賬號:jojo,密碼:bean(注:web頁設置為啟用隱藏字段標記(Session),所以需要關聯) 二、分析腳本 ?1.web_url詳解 函數形式:web_url( const char *StepName, const char *url, , [EXTRARES, ,] LAST );?
2.web_submit_data詳解 函數形式:web_submit_data( const char *StepName, const char *Action, , ITEMDATA, , [ EXTRARES, ,] LAST );?

?

3.腳本實例

Action()
{

web_url("WebTours",//VuGen中樹形視圖中顯示的名稱,在自動事務處理中也可以用做事務的名稱
"URL=http://127.0.0.1:1080/WebTours/",//頁面url地址
"TargetFrame=",//包含當前連接、資源的Frame名稱
"Resource=0",//這個URL是否是一個資源,0 表示不是資源,1 表示是資源

"RecContentType=text/html",
//RecContentType:報頭文本類型,(text/html,或者 application/x- javascript),確認目標URL是否是可錄制的資源

"Referer=",
//Referer:要提交頁面請求的URL(獲得當前頁面,如果明確指出了位置,那么這個屬性無效或者忽略。URL中寫明了,要獲取的頁面)

"Snapshot=t1.inf", //Snapshot:快照,快照文件名稱,用來關聯用
"Mode=HTML", //Mode:錄制的等級,分為HTML或者HTTP模式
LAST);//LAST:屬性列表結束的標記符

lr_think_time(13);
//是虛擬用戶在執行腳本是,停留在那不執行的等待時間,比如說登陸系統后等一段時間后在進行操作

web_submit_data("login.pl", //VuGen中樹形視圖中顯示的名稱,在自動事務處理中也可以用作事務的名稱
"Action=http://127.0.0.1:1080/WebTours/login.pl",//執行表單提交的URL地址,語法如下:Action=<urlAddress>
"Method=POST", //提交表單的方法,可取值有GET,POST
"TargetFrame=", //包含當前連接、資源的Frame名稱
"RecContentType=text/html",//:報頭文本類型
"Referer=http://127.0.0.1:1080/WebTours/nav.pl?in=home",//要提交該頁面請求的URL
"Snapshot=t2.inf",//快照
"Mode=HTML",//錄制模式
ITEMDATA, //屬性和數據列表的分割標記
"Name=userSession", "Value=121733.628918591zczVzHDpfDHfDHfHApAtVccf", ENDITEM,
"Name=username", "Value=jojo", ENDITEM,
"Name=password", "Value=bean", ENDITEM,
"Name=JSFormSubmit", "Value=on", ENDITEM,
"Name=login.x", "Value=73", ENDITEM,
"Name=login.y", "Value=17", ENDITEM,
LAST);//參數列表結束標志

web_url("Search Flights Button",
"URL=http://127.0.0.1:1080/WebTours/welcome.pl?page=search",
"TargetFrame=body",
"Resource=0",
"RecContentType=text/html",
"Referer=http://127.0.0.1:1080/WebTours/nav.pl?page=menu&in=home",
"Snapshot=t3.inf",
"Mode=HTML",
LAST);

lr_think_time(8);

web_submit_data("reservations.pl",
"Action=http://127.0.0.1:1080/WebTours/reservations.pl",
"Method=POST",
"TargetFrame=",
"RecContentType=text/html",
"Referer=http://127.0.0.1:1080/WebTours/reservations.pl?page=welcome",
"Snapshot=t4.inf",
"Mode=HTML",
ITEMDATA,
"Name=advanceDiscount", "Value=0", ENDITEM,
"Name=depart", "Value=London", ENDITEM,
"Name=departDate", "Value=08/16/2017", ENDITEM,
"Name=arrive", "Value=Los Angeles", ENDITEM,
"Name=returnDate", "Value=08/17/2017", ENDITEM,
"Name=numPassengers", "Value=1", ENDITEM,
"Name=seatPref", "Value=None", ENDITEM,
"Name=seatType", "Value=Coach", ENDITEM,
"Name=.cgifields", "Value=roundtrip", ENDITEM,
"Name=.cgifields", "Value=seatType", ENDITEM,
"Name=.cgifields", "Value=seatPref", ENDITEM,
"Name=findFlights.x", "Value=63", ENDITEM,
"Name=findFlights.y", "Value=11", ENDITEM,
LAST);

web_submit_data("reservations.pl_2",
"Action=http://127.0.0.1:1080/WebTours/reservations.pl",
"Method=POST",
"TargetFrame=",
"RecContentType=text/html",
"Referer=http://127.0.0.1:1080/WebTours/reservations.pl",
"Snapshot=t5.inf",
"Mode=HTML",
ITEMDATA,
"Name=outboundFlight", "Value=230;773;08/16/2017", ENDITEM,
"Name=numPassengers", "Value=1", ENDITEM,
"Name=advanceDiscount", "Value=0", ENDITEM,
"Name=seatType", "Value=Coach", ENDITEM,
"Name=seatPref", "Value=None", ENDITEM,
"Name=reserveFlights.x", "Value=30", ENDITEM,
"Name=reserveFlights.y", "Value=13", ENDITEM,
LAST);

lr_think_time(6);

web_submit_data("reservations.pl_3",
"Action=http://127.0.0.1:1080/WebTours/reservations.pl",
"Method=POST",
"TargetFrame=",
"RecContentType=text/html",
"Referer=http://127.0.0.1:1080/WebTours/reservations.pl",
"Snapshot=t6.inf",
"Mode=HTML",
ITEMDATA,
"Name=firstName", "Value=Joseph", ENDITEM,
"Name=lastName", "Value=Marshall", ENDITEM,
"Name=address1", "Value=234 Willow Drive", ENDITEM,
"Name=address2", "Value=San Jose/CA/94085", ENDITEM,
"Name=pass1", "Value=Joseph Marshall", ENDITEM,
"Name=creditCard", "Value=112233", ENDITEM,
"Name=expDate", "Value=", ENDITEM,
"Name=oldCCOption", "Value=", ENDITEM,
"Name=numPassengers", "Value=1", ENDITEM,
"Name=seatType", "Value=Coach", ENDITEM,
"Name=seatPref", "Value=None", ENDITEM,
"Name=outboundFlight", "Value=230;773;08/16/2017", ENDITEM,
"Name=advanceDiscount", "Value=0", ENDITEM,
"Name=returnFlight", "Value=", ENDITEM,
"Name=JSFormSubmit", "Value=off", ENDITEM,
"Name=.cgifields", "Value=saveCC", ENDITEM,
"Name=buyFlights.x", "Value=83", ENDITEM,
"Name=buyFlights.y", "Value=9", ENDITEM,
LAST);

lr_think_time(8);

web_url("SignOff Button",
"URL=http://127.0.0.1:1080/WebTours/welcome.pl?signOff=1",
"TargetFrame=body",
"Resource=0",
"RecContentType=text/html",
"Referer=http://127.0.0.1:1080/WebTours/nav.pl?page=menu&in=flights",
"Snapshot=t7.inf",
"Mode=HTML",
LAST);

return 0;
}

三、Replay回放

1.設置“Open Run-Time Settings”

general==》log==》extended log==》全部勾選

2.顯示run-time viewer:Tools==>General Options==>show run-time viewer during rep

3.Start Replay

4.有報錯,手動關聯;又是沒有報錯,但是replay log 中有報錯(紅色字)

5.顯示結果:View==》Test Result

?四、Enhancing the Script內容驗證

1.Run-time Settings==>preferences==>勾選enable image and text check

2.Content Checks==》選中內容==》右擊==》add a text check

3.腳本內容變化

?

?

?

?

轉載于:https://www.cnblogs.com/meidang/p/7367621.html

總結

以上是生活随笔為你收集整理的LoadRunner-登陆web tours订票网站,预订一张机票后退出-1的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。

主站蜘蛛池模板: 国产精品VideoSex性欧美 | 欧美福利视频一区 | 波多野结衣在线观看一区二区 | 欧美激情在线免费 | 日韩欧美二区 | 亚洲调教 | 黄色裸体视频 | 处破女av一区二区 | 无码国产色欲xxxx视频 | 日本黄色免费网站 | 欧美成人做爰大片免费看黄石 | 亚洲尤物在线 | 天堂在线中文网 | 特极毛片 | 国产精品欧美精品 | 韩国不卡av | 中文字幕11页中文字幕11页 | 91娇羞白丝网站 | 777精品伊人久久久久大香线蕉 | 亚洲欧洲视频 | 日产精品一区 | 在线免费黄色网址 | 日本一区不卡 | 999精品视频| 中出在线播放 | 一起草av在线 | 理论片琪琪午夜电影 | ass日本粉嫩pics珍品 | 欧美理论视频 | 男生插女生的网站 | 99免费在线 | 粉嫩小箩莉奶水四溅在线观看 | 精品视频久久久久 | 国产中文字幕视频 | 电影寂寞少女免费观看 | 国产女女做受ⅹxx高潮 | 另类综合小说 | 96亚洲精品久久久蜜桃 | 激情小说视频在线 | 午夜国产视频 | 亚洲熟妇无码另类久久久 | 超91在线| 婷婷色中文网 | 激情亚洲视频 | 男人舔女人下部高潮全视频 | 国产激情文学 | 一卡二卡精品 | 潘金莲黄色一级片 | 青青草国产在线视频 | 五月综合激情 | 国产免费无码一区二区视频 | 国产一区二区三区在线播放无 | 高跟鞋av | 日韩激情一区 | av一区二区三区免费观看 | 天天插av | 红桃成人在线 | 女人性高潮视频 | 日韩精彩视频 | 女性爱爱视频 | 91在线一区| 免费在线观看视频a | 日本啪啪网 | 男女做爰猛烈吃奶啪啪喷水网站 | 视色网站 | 中文字幕自拍 | 和美女啪啪 | 免费人成自慰网站 | 久久免费精品视频 | 九九热在线观看 | 精品毛片在线观看 | 你懂的在线免费观看 | 野外(巨肉高h) | 婷婷视频网 | 欧美插插视频 | 老妇女av| 在线视频观看一区二区 | 亚洲视频在线看 | 播放黄色一级片 | 国产第一页在线播放 | www国产黄色 | 久久综合狠狠综合久久综合88 | 91精品欧美一区二区三区 | 久久久老熟女一区二区三区91 | 深夜福利91| 你懂的国产视频 | 黄色片aa| 粗大挺进潘金莲身体在线播放 | 国产一区免费在线观看 | 在线日韩一区二区 | 女~淫辱の触手3d动漫 | 亚洲 激情 | 99久久国产宗和精品1上映 | 爱情岛av永久入口 | 精品国产99久久久久久 | 91精品国产综合久久久蜜臀九色 | 久久丫丫 | 又大又硬又爽免费视频 | 手机av免费在线观看 |